Từ 1 tới 3 trên tổng số 3 kết quả

Đề tài: Lỗi insert data kiểu date

  1. #1
    Ngày gia nhập
    03 2013
    Bài viết
    3

    Question Lỗi insert data kiểu date

    trong phần create table em có tạo một bảng như thế này :
    Code:
    CREATE TABLE CHUONG_TRINH_KHUYEN_MAI
    (
      MSKM INT NOT NULL PRIMARY KEY,
      TEN VARCHAR2(100) NOT NULL,
      TG_BAT_DAU DATE NOT NULL, 
      TG_KET_THUC DATE NOT NULL,
      NOI_DUNG VARCHAR2(100),
      CHECK(REGEXP_LIKE(TG_BAT_DAU, 'DD/MM/YYYY')),
      CHECK(REGEXP_LIKE(TG_KET_THUC, 'DD/MM/YYYY')),
      CHECK(TG_BAT_DAU <= TG_KET_THUC)
    );
    phần insert :
    Code:
    INSERT INTO CHUONG_TRINH_KHUYEN_MAI(MSKM,TEN, TG_BAT_DAU, TG_KET_THUC, NOI_DUNG)
    VALUES ('1','Khuyen Mai',TO_DATE('05/06/2015','DD/MM/YYYY'),TO_DATE('09/06/2015','DD/MM/YYYY'), 'Tang 1 chuot')
    chạy thì gặp lỗi "check constrait (%.%) violated "
    Mọi người giúp em vs ạ!!!!
    -ngoc nhung-

  2. #2
    Ngày gia nhập
    08 2014
    Nơi ở
    USA
    Bài viết
    624

    '1' chuyển thành 1
    VNFox là ai? www.vnfox.com
    Cafe cùng VNFox @ fb.me/vnfoxcafe

  3. #3
    Ngày gia nhập
    03 2013
    Bài viết
    3

    Trích dẫn Nguyên bản được gửi bởi VNFox Xem bài viết
    '1' chuyển thành 1
    chuyển thành 1 không được đâu bạn, vì nếu bỏ dòng check ngày tháng thì không có vấn đề gì cả.
    -ngoc nhung-

Tags của đề tài này

Quyền hạn của bạn

  • Bạn không thể gửi đề tài mới
  • Bạn không thể gửi bài trả lời
  • Bạn không thể gửi các đính kèm
  • Bạn không thể chỉnh sửa bài viết của bạn